본문 바로가기

회고/WIL : Weekly I Learned

[WIL] 220904 내일배움캠프 1주차

FACTS(사실, 객관)   이번 일주일 동안 있었던 일, 내가 한 일

 

1. 웹개발 종합반(웹 프로그래밍 A-Z 기초) 복습

2. 미니 프로젝트 진행 및 발표

3. 파이썬 문법 기초 완강

4. 백준 단계별 문제(입출력과 사칙연산, 조건문) 풀기

 

 

 

FINDINGS(배운 것)   그 상황으로부터 내가 배운 것, 얻은 것

 

1. 웹개발 종합반을 처음 수강할 때 제일 어려워했던 부분이 서버에 요청하고 클라이언트로 응답하는 부분이었는데 이해가 될 때까지 반복 재생하고 내용을 정리하다보니 서버와 클라이언트가 어떻게 상호작용 하는지 더 잘 이해할 수 있었다. 

 

2. 예제를 카피하는 것이 아닌 스스로 기획한 페이지를 만들려다보니까 기본이 되는 큰 틀을 만드는 것 조차도 어려웠다. 강의에서 배우지 않은 grid라는 속성을 활용해 작은 화면에도 대응할 수 있도록 시도했는데, 서브 개인 페이지에는 그런대로 성공했지만 메인 팀 소개 페이지에서는 제대로 구현하지 못해서 아쉬웠다. 그래도 강의에서 배우지 않은 부분을 여러번 시도하면서 grid와 css로 개체들을 배치하는 방법에 대해 더 익힐 수 있었다. 

 

3. 다른 언어들에 배해 간결하고 짧게 줄여 쓸 수 있다는 특징을 가진 파이썬에 대해 기초 지식을 배웠다. 지난 사전 과제 강의로 배운 내용도 몇몇 있었지만 이번 기회에 다시 복기하고 추가로 더 많은 내용들을 배웠다. 학습을 통해 조건문, 반복문을 더 잘 이해할 수 있었고 집합이나 활용도가 높은  f-string, filter에 대해서도 알게 되었다. 

 

4. 기초 문법 강의에서 학습한 내용을 응용해 볼 수 있었다. 맨 처음 간단한 몇 문제는 막힘없이 풀었는데 뒤로 갈수록 어려웠다. 문제에 어떻게 접근해야 할지조차도 가늠이 어려웠지만 답안을 검색해 보면서 문제를 풀어나가는 다양한 방식들을 알 수 있었다. 아직 배운 지식들로 응용하는 것이 쉽지 않지만 계속 반복하면서 익숙해지도록 노력해야겠다.

 

 

 

FEELINGS(느낌, 주관)   과정에서 느낀점과 생각

 

반복하지 않으면 금세 잊혀지기 때문에 틈틈이 복습해서 손과 눈에 익숙해지도록 만들어야겠다. 그리고 복습 과정에서 몇 번 오류를 겪었는데 오타나 들여쓰기, 괄호가 원인이었다. 익숙해졌다고 방심하지 말고 한번 더 체크하는 습관을 길러야겠다. 

 

 

 

FUTURE(미래)   배운 것을 미래에는 어떻게 적용할 지

 

- 코드 작성 후 천천히 오타, 들여쓰기, 괄호 확인하기

- 당일에 배운 내용들은 전체적으로 가볍게 복기, 어려웠던 부분 체크